Job Search and Career Advice Platform

Attiva gli avvisi di lavoro via e-mail!

Firmware Engineer

idpp

Vimercate

In loco

EUR 40.000 - 60.000

Tempo pieno

28 giorni fa

Genera un CV personalizzato in pochi minuti

Ottieni un colloquio e una retribuzione più elevata. Scopri di più

Descrizione del lavoro

A technology company in Vimercate seeks a skilled Firmware Engineer for full-time, on-site work on embedded systems. Responsibilities include designing and testing firmware, collaborating with cross-functional teams, and troubleshooting. Ideal candidates should be proficient in C, have experience with ARM/Cortex microcontrollers, and a passion for technology and innovation. A collaborative work environment awaits those eager to tackle technical challenges.

Competenze

  • Strong proficiency in C programming.
  • Solid understanding of ARM / Cortex microcontrollers.
  • Experience in developing device drivers and BSPs for embedded systems.
  • Proactive, team-oriented mindset with excellent problem-solving skills.
  • Passion for technology and innovation.

Mansioni

  • Design, develop, and test firmware for embedded systems.
  • Collaborate with teams to define technical requirements.
  • Troubleshoot, debug, and optimize firmware performance.

Conoscenze

C programming
ARM / Cortex microcontrollers
Device driver development
Problem-solving
Team collaboration

Strumenti

Lauterbach Trace32
GDB
Descrizione del lavoro
Overview

Firmware Engineer — We are seeking a skilled Firmware Engineer to join an embedded systems development project based in Vimercate Nord. The role involves full-time, on-site collaboration on advanced firmware solutions within a multidisciplinary environment.

Responsibilities
  • Design, develop, and test firmware for embedded systems.
  • Work with ARM / Cortex microcontrollers and Board Support Packages (BSPs).
  • Collaborate with cross-functional teams to define technical requirements and implement robust, efficient solutions.
  • Troubleshoot, debug, and optimize firmware performance.
Requirements
  • Strong proficiency in C programming .
  • Solid understanding of ARM / Cortex microcontrollers .
  • Experience developing device drivers and BSPs for commercial or custom boards.
  • Proactive, team-oriented mindset with excellent problem-solving skills.
  • Passion for technology and innovation.
Preferred Qualifications
  • Experience using laboratory instrumentation and debugging tools (e.g., Lauterbach Trace32, GDB).
  • Familiarity with Modbus or other serial communication protocols.
  • Approximately 6 years of experience in embedded or real-time software development.
Work Environment
  • On-site work required : 5 days per week.
  • Collaborative and technically challenging environment focused on innovation in embedded systems.
Equal Opportunity

This position is open to applicants of all genders (in accordance with Italian laws 903 / 77 and 125 / 91) and to individuals belonging to protected categories under Law 68 / 99.

Ottieni la revisione del curriculum gratis e riservata.
oppure trascina qui un file PDF, DOC, DOCX, ODT o PAGES di non oltre 5 MB.